期货量化交易是一种利用计算机程序和数学模型进行期货交易的自动化方式。它通过分析历史数据、识别市场规律和制定交易策略来做出交易决策。
1. 数据收集和分析
期货量化交易的第一步是收集和分析历史数据。这些数据包括市场价格、成交量、持仓量等。通过对这些数据的分析,量化交易员可以识别市场中的趋势和规律,为交易策略的制定提供依据。
2. 交易策略制定
交易策略是量化交易的核心。它定义了交易的时机、品种、数量和持仓时间等参数。量化交易员会根据历史数据的分析,结合自己的交易理念,制定出特定的交易策略。
交易策略的制定需要考虑以下因素:
- 市场趋势:识别市场中的趋势,并制定顺应趋势的交易策略。
- 技术指标:利用技术指标,如均线、布林带、MACD等,分析市场走势,寻找交易机会。
- 风险控制:制定严格的风险控制措施,如止损、仓位管理等,以控制交易风险。
3. 交易执行
一旦交易策略制定完成,量化交易程序就会根据策略自动执行交易。程序会实时监控市场数据,并在满足策略条件时,自动下单或平仓。
期货量化交易的优势在于:
- 自动化:交易过程完全自动化,无需人工干预,避免了情绪化交易。
- 客观性:基于历史数据和数学模型,交易决策更加客观,不受主观因素影响。
- 高效率:计算机程序可以快速处理大量数据,并做出及时准确的交易决策。
- 回测和优化:可以通过回测,检验交易策略的有效性,并进行优化调整。
需要注意的是,期货量化交易并不是一种无风险的投资方式。它需要对市场有深入的了解,并制定合理的交易策略。同时,量化交易程序也可能出现故障或错误,导致交易损失。在进行期货量化交易之前,投资者需要充分了解其风险,并做好相应的风险管理措施。
期货量化交易的类型
期货量化交易可以分为以下几种类型:
- 趋势跟踪:顺应市场趋势,在趋势形成时买入或卖出,并在趋势反转时平仓。
- 区间交易:在市场波动范围内进行交易,在价格触及区间边界时买入或卖出,并在价格反弹时平仓。
- 套利交易:利用不同市场或合约之间的价格差异进行交易,以获取无风险收益。
- 高频交易:利用高速计算机和算法,在极短的时间内进行大量交易,以获取微小的价格差。
期货量化交易的应用
期货量化交易广泛应用于期货市场,包括商品期货、金融期货和股指期货等。它可以帮助投资者:
- 捕捉市场趋势:通过识别市场趋势,在趋势形成时及时介入,获取趋势收益。
- 降低交易成本:自动化交易可以降低人工交易的成本,如佣金、滑点等。
- 提高交易效率:计算机程序可以快速处理大量数据,并做出及时准确的交易决策。
- 分散投资风险:通过同时交易多个品种或策略,可以分散投资风险,提高投资组合的稳定性。
期货量化交易是一种利用计算机程序和数学模型进行期货交易的自动化方式。它通过分析历史数据、识别市场规律和制定交易策略来做出交易决策。期货量化交易具有自动化、客观性、高效率和回测优化等优势,可以帮助投资者捕捉市场趋势、降低交易成本、提高交易效率和分散投资风险。
文章来源于网络,有用户自行上传自期货排行网,版权归原作者所有,如若转载,请注明出处:https://www.meihuadianqi.com/279993.html